  5. 5. A Defense of Helene Landemore’s Argument for the Epistemic Superiority of Democratic Deliberation

    University essay from Umeå universitet/Institutionen för idé- och samhällsstudier

    Author : Ivar Larsson; [2023]
    Keywords : Democracy; epistemic democracy;

    Abstract : In this essay I investigate whether political deliberation in an assembly of 300 people that is randomly selected from the entire population (democratic deliberation) is epistemically superior to political deliberation in an assembly of the same size where individuals have been selected based on certain criteria (non-democratic deliberation). I present Helene Landemore’s argument in favor of the epistemic superiority of democratic deliberation and consider Aaron Ancell’s critique of this argument. READ MORE
